Auto-linking is a feature of Moodle by which words or phrases used within a Moodle site are automatically linked (by highlighting in grey by default) if there is a content page (or resource or activity or glossary entry) within the site with the same name.

Autolinking can be switched on/off sitewide by going to Settings>Site Administration>Plugins>Filters>Manage Filters. and it can also be managed within individual courses from Settings>Course Administration>Filters

For more information on autolinking, see Filters

Specific links can be prevented by adding <nolink> ... </nolink> tags around the relevant content in HTML markup mode.

Another way to force autolinking on/off is to use:

  • <span class="link">text</span>
  • <span class="nolink">text</span>
